Company Overview: Tata Electronics Private Limited (TEPL) is a greenfield venture of the Tata Group, specializing in manufacturing precision components. As a wholly owned subsidiary of Tata Sons Pvt. Ltd., Tata Electronics is building India’s first AI-enabled state-of-the-art Semiconductor Foundry. This facility will produce chips for applications such as power management ICs, display drivers, microcontrollers (MCUs), and high-performance computing logic, addressing the growing demand in markets such as automotive, computing and data storage, wireless communications, and artificial intelligence.

The Tata Group operates in more than 100 countries across six continents, with the mission "To improve the quality of life of the communities we serve globally, through long-term stakeholder value creation based on leadership with Trust."
